Transaction 116bc851431f5ccdfee018df738580b6d9c13f97526bd494cdd8c6421a194e7f

1 Input
2 Outputs
  • 116bc851431f5ccdfee018df738580b6d9c13f97526bd494cdd8c6421a194e7f:0
  • value  71642
    address  1EcnJFxc9S3AxgfZFUvGYLPMrSMr7n5Ugg
  • 116bc851431f5ccdfee018df738580b6d9c13f97526bd494cdd8c6421a194e7f:1
  • value  28039000
    address  3E1mf6G3CKjSYsGeHQtHhUpAwDgEenodog